Sunderland's Wahbi Khazri the hero as Tunisia win fiercely-contested North African World Cup derby
Khazri converted a 50th-minute penalty to sink North African rivals Libya in African qualifying Group A, after the hosts – forced to play their home game in neutral Algiers – had Ali Salama sent off for a second bookable offence in conceding the spot-kick.
Tunisia, with two wins out of two so far, next meet second-top Congo DR in August, in the third game in a six-match section.
